Did you renew the DHCP lease of the device you tested from after making changes in the hub?

The custom DNS feature on the EE hubs does not change the DNS resolvers assigned to the WAN connection of the router. Instead it modifies the DHCP server to issue your custom DNS addresses as part of the DHCP lease when a device establishes a connection to the hub (similar to you explicitly configuring DNS on the network adapter).
